The Latest BMW Logo is Partially Invisible and Barely Distinguishable BMW’s latest logo redesign ditches the black ring for a transparent circle, for the first time in 23 years, and car lovers are not even sure if it’s an improvement Unveiling its latest logo, alongside an all-new, all-electric four-door BMW Concept i4 Gran Coupe, the Munich-based automaker, presented its iconic roundel design… in 2D . The Latest BMW Logo is Partially Invisible and Barely Distinguishable Applicable across a multitude of online and offline platforms, the new logo’s flatter, transparent design not only showcases visual and graphic restraint, but is expected to illuminate on vehicles and in showrooms. Developed in collaboration with Munich-based studio, BECC Agency , BMW’s newest design has since sparked immense controversy, leaving brand-enthusiasts divided in their judgements.
